The Five-Layer Birthday Cake

No reporters were present at Yalta. But three U.S. newsmen arrived after the conference broke up, made the long trip home with the President. This week the Associated Press's White House correspondent, Douglas B. Cornell, gathered up his notes, published five articles on Yalta. Some hitherto unknown incidents:

ΒΆ A minor crisis arose on the trip to Yalta when the President observed his 63rd birthday. The President's chefs had baked a cake; so had the cooks for the officers' mess. It looked as though one group of chefs would be disappointed, until Daughter Anna Boettiger solved the dilemma....
